Halloween by the Bucky Bingo numbers
We love Halloween here at Bucky, so we've put together a few facts and figures to get you ready for the big day!
31 - Halloween is celebrated on the 31st October and originally began as a Celtic celebration. The Celts believed that the Lord of Death released souls back to Earth on this day, coinciding with the end of the harvest season.
8 - Apparently, there are eight holidays for witches, including Halloween. Most of them cross with Earth festivals like the equinox, as well as the harvest, but Beltane celebrated on May 1st is a day on which the god and goddess of fertility are honoured.
10 - There have been ten films in the Halloween movie franchise. This number includes remakes of Halloween I and II, directed by hard rocker Rob Zombie.
